Why Diagnostic Quality and Access Matter Here
Two practical realities shape the local market. First, high chronic disease prevalence means frequent recurring tests such as A1C, lipid panels, kidney function, and thyroid studies, so per-test cost and wait times accumulate. Second, El Paso's binational and geographically dispersed population creates real access differences between the Westside medical corridor and outlying areas like Horizon City, Socorro, or the far Northeast. A lab with broad neighborhood coverage and electronic result delivery removes friction from ongoing care.

Trends in Diagnostic Medicine
The field is advancing quickly. Molecular and genetic testing has moved from specialty to mainstream, informing cancer treatment selection, pharmacogenomics, and inherited disease risk. Point-of-care testing now delivers results during a single clinic visit for many analytes, compressing diagnosis timelines. Artificial intelligence tools increasingly assist radiologists in flagging findings on imaging studies, functioning as a second reader rather than a replacement. Patient-facing portals have normalized direct result access, and price transparency requirements are gradually making self-pay comparison shopping realistic.
How to Choose a Diagnostic Provider
Always confirm that the specific facility, not just the brand, is in your insurance network, and ask whether the radiologist interpretation is billed separately from the scan. For self-pay, request the cash price explicitly, since it is often far lower than the billed rate. Verify that results will be transmitted directly to your ordering physician and that you can access them yourself. For imaging, ask about equipment specifications when precision matters, and for repeat monitoring, use the same laboratory consistently so results remain methodologically comparable over time.
